EMILY: That sounds like a great career path. What kind of practical applications can we expect from hydrokinetic energy harvesting and grid connection? DAVID: There are many exciting applications, Emily. For example, hydrokinetic energy can be used to power isolated communities, provide backup power during outages, or even integrate with existing grid systems. The possibilities are vast, and our program prepares students to explore and develop these opportunities. EMILY: I see. Can you tell us a bit more about the curriculum?
